How to boil potatoes with the skin on?

To boil potatoes with the skin on, start by washing the potatoes thoroughly. Place them in a pot and cover them with water. Add a pinch of salt and bring the water to a boil. Reduce the heat and let the potatoes simmer for about 15-20 minutes, or until they are tender when pierced with a fork. Drain the water and let the potatoes cool before peeling or using them in your recipe.

How long do I need to boil tomatoes in order to easily peel off the skin?

To easily peel off the skin of tomatoes, you should boil them for about 30 seconds to 1 minute. This brief boiling time helps loosen the skin, making it easier to remove.
